Majid Majidi FilmsMajid Majidi is a prominent figure in Iranian cinema, known for his poignant storytelling and vivid imagery. His films often explore themes of innocence, struggle, and human resilience. In 2001, Majidi continued to build his reputation with works that showcased his unique directorial style. For instance, his film "Baran" is a testament to his ability to weave complex narratives with simple, yet powerful visuals. Majidi's films are characterized by their deep emotional resonance and their focus on the everyday lives of ordinary people. Iranian Cinema AnalysisIranian cinema has always been celebrated for its poetic realism and profound storytelling. The year 2001 was no exception, with films that offered a glimpse into the cultural and social fabric of Iran. These films often employ a minimalist approach, focusing on character development and intricate plotlines rather than lavish sets or special effects. For example, the use of natural landscapes and everyday settings in films like "Baran" creates an authentic atmosphere that draws viewers in. Baran CinematographyThe cinematography in "Baran" is a standout feature, characterized by its stark beauty and emotional depth. The film's visual language is simple yet evocative, with each frame carefully composed to convey the story's underlying emotions. For instance, the use of natural light and the stark contrast between indoor and outdoor scenes enhance the narrative's emotional impact. The cinematography in "Baran" is not just about capturing images; it's about telling a story through visuals. Symbolism plays a crucial role in Persian cinema, adding layers of meaning to the narrative. In "Baran," for example, the recurring motif of rain symbolizes renewal and hope, reflecting the protagonist's emotional journey. The use of symbolic elements is not just limited to visuals but extends to the storyline and character arcs as well. For instance, the character of Baran herself represents a beacon of hope and change in the lives of those around her. "Baran" is a film that transcends traditional genre classifications, blending elements of drama, romance, and social realism. At its core, it is a deeply human story that explores the complexities of love and the struggles of everyday life. The film's genre can be described as a poetic realism, a style that is characteristic of many Iranian films. This genre is marked by its focus on the mundane aspects of life, elevating them to a level of poetic beauty.
